Transaction 96d1835b34c106a5d03dffb452da8cae6c6545219cf40bbac2a8aba70c94eca1
1 Input
1 Output
-
96d1835b34c106a5d03dffb452da8cae6c6545219cf40bbac2a8aba70c94eca1:0
- value
- 5959840879
- script pubkey
- OP_0 OP_PUSHBYTES_32 27da5a0c2eb710063da6296dd4c2691104bbffde32296d892a10b82025bbbeb5
- address
- bc1qyld95rpwkugqv0dx99kafsnfzyzthl77xg5kmzf2zzuzqfdmh66smjje2v